What is the difference between Part Time Instructor vs Adjunct Professor?
| Aspect | Part Time Instructor | Adjunct Professor |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ires a relevant degree or professional experience | Usually requires a master's degree or higher in the subject area |
| Work Environment | Often teaches at community colleges, vocational schools, or training programs | Primarily teaches at colleges or universities |
| Employer & Industry | Educational institutions, training centers | Higher education institutions, universities |
| Workload & Compensation | Part-time, variable hours, paid per course or hour | Part-time, often contract-based, paid per course or semester |
While both roles involve teaching on a part-time basis, Part Time Instructors typically work in a variety of educational settings and may have more flexible credentials, whereas Adjunct Professors usually hold advanced degrees and teach at higher education institutions. The choice depends on your qualifications and career goals in education.

Position Summary
CNM faculty are vital to the College's vision of "changing lives, building community." This vision is evidenced by a commitment to teaching and learning that supports our goals of student success, increased student retention, and improved graduation rates. Faculty are responsible for providing high quality instruction that meets the needs of diverse learners so that each student may meet course outcomes and achieve their educational goals. An instructor is responsible for providing high quality instruction so that each student may meet course outcomes. Collaborate with the Dean and colleagues to improve the student learning experience. Being hired into the regular part-time instructor pool is not a guarantee of employment. Classes are assigned on an as-needed basis. Hours will vary each class and by term. The number of openings for instructors is dependent upon student enrollment.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Responsible for effectively preparing, teaching, grading, and assessing student learning in courses assigned.
- Create and model a quality learning environment to support a diverse student population including students with disabilities or special learning needs.
- Maintain student records and provide documentation for in-completes within established College timelines.
- Utilize a variety of technology-based programs to access and input information related to student records and college/school/department processes.
- Assist students with registration, advising, and graduation processes.
- Structure classes and curriculum to correspond with program and course outcomes.
- Prepare, distribute and utilize instructional support materials, including course syllabi, supplementary materials,instructional media and other devices as appropriate.
- Convene classes as scheduled and respond to student inquiries.
- Assist students outside the classroom through posted office hours.
- Attend in-service sessions, college/school/department meetings, graduation and convocation as required.
- Performs other job related duties as assigned
Minimum Qualifications:
- Five (5) years of recent industry experience in commercial or residential construction or an equivalent combination of education and experience
- Experience providing construction related training
Preferences:
- Computer literacy/experience in Microsoft Office applications
- An associate's degree or higher from an accredited institution
- Residential Contractor License (GB2 or GB98)
- OSHA 10/OSHA 30 training credential
